Synopsis

Civil Disobedience by Thoreau has been one of the most historically significant and influential essays ever written. Since its initial publication in 1849 it has inspired resistance movements from the Danish WWII underground in the 1940s to the South African anti-apartheid movement at the end of the 20th Century. Seminal leaders from Mahatma Gandhi to Martin Luther King have found encouragement and enlightenment in Thoreau's words.
